The COPD Score in 04416, Bucksport, Maine is 56 out of 100 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.
79.45 percent of the population in 04416 drive to work alone. 0.72 percent of the people take some form of public transportation like the bus or the train to work. Approximately 36.09 percent of the residents get to work in less than 30 minutes. 7.67 percent of the residents in 04416 get to work in more than 60 minutes. The average household size is approximately 2.02 members with about 2.03 cars available per household.
An estimate of 94.77 percent of the residents in 04416 has some form of health insurance. 43.40 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 70.56 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.
A resident in 04416 would have to travel an average of 13.54 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, Northern Light Eastern Maine Medical Center . In a 20-mile radius, there are 0 healthcare providers accessible to residents in 04416, Bucksport, Maine.

As of , an estimate of 5,585 residents live in 04416 with a median age of 41.8 years. 23.76 percent of the population is under the age of 18, and 24.96 percent of the population is at least 65 years of age. 37.18 percent of the residents in 04416 is currently married, and 15.27 percent of the population has never been married.
The monthly median household income in 04416 is $4,978.92. The monthly median housing costs for residents in 04416 is approximately $904. The median household spends about 18.16 percent of their income on housing.

For individuals with COPD, access to specialized care and treatment is essential for managing their condition. COPD is a chronic inflammatory lung disease that causes obstructed airflow from the lungs. It can lead to severe symptoms such as shortness of breath, coughing, and wheezing. Managing COPD often requires regular visits to healthcare providers for check-ups, medication management, and pulmonary rehabilitation programs.

Brief History of Bucksport
As potential movers consider relocating to Bucksport, understanding the town's history can provide valuable insights into its appeal. Established in the early 18th century as part of the Massachusetts Bay Colony, Bucksport has a rich maritime heritage due to its strategic location along the Penobscot River. The town's historical significance is evident in its well-preserved architecture and landmarks that reflect its seafaring past.
